EP90. The Odyssey Isn't Satire, But Robots Can Be: Ann Droid & Androids

Smith & Waugh Talk About Satire·Talk About Satire·12 September 2026·1h 9m

About this episode

What makes a robot funny? And, more importantly, are they satire? Jo and Adam ask why robots seem to lend themselves so readily to satirical comedy. They look at the BBC sitcom ANN DROID, Apple TV's SUNNY and Channel 4's prank show BAD ROBOTS, alongside various satirical machines including Kryten from RED DWARF, Bender from FUTURAMA and ROBOCOP. There are also honourable mentions for robots who are decidedly less satirical (Vision, Data, the various artificial humans of HUMANS and BLACK MIRROR) as they consider what separates a robot who makes us laugh from one who simply makes us think (or are they perhaps the same, ahhhh....). Along the way, they discuss Isaac Asimov, The Bicentennial Man, and the peculiar relationship between robots, humanity and satire. And, because no episode is complete without getting distracted by something else, Jo and Adam share their thoughts on The Odyssey and the memes it has generated.
